Mehrwertsteuervalidierung für nicht angemeldete Kunden oder Gäste

7

Ich arbeite an dieser Anforderung von meinem EU-Kunden. Wir arbeiten mit Magento 1.9.1.
Wir haben die Mehrwertsteuervalidierung und die automatische Gruppenänderung basierend auf gültigen und ungültigen Mehrwertsteuer-IDs und deren Funktionsweise eingerichtet.

Jetzt wollen wir die Mehrwertsteuer für Kunden validieren, die nicht angemeldet sind, und sie in eine Kundengruppe verschieben, die "Nicht angemeldete gültige Mehrwertsteuer" sagt.

Ist es möglich, einen Gast einer Kundengruppe zuzuweisen, da der Gast eigentlich keine vollständige Kundeneinheit ist? Ist es möglich, das Konzept der nicht angemeldeten Kundengruppe zu replizieren?

Hashid
quelle

Antworten:

2

Es macht überhaupt keinen Sinn, keinen Kunden in eine Kundengruppe aufzunehmen :-)

Aber die ganze Mehrwertsteuer-Sache basiert auf der Kundengruppe und was Sie tun könnten, ist, dies zu fälschen.

Speichern Sie die Mehrwertsteuer in der Sitzung und validieren Sie sie zuvor. Stellen Sie dann nach Abschluss der Prüfung sicher, dass Mage::getSingleton('customer/session')->getCustomerGroup()der gewünschte Wert zurückgegeben wird. Entweder durch Umschreiben oder besser durch Festlegen der Kundengruppe. Ich bin mir aber nicht sicher, ob es immer ein leeres Kundenobjekt gibt, das missbraucht werden kann.

Viel Glück. Sag mir, wie es funktioniert, ich denke, ich muss das gleiche bald tun.

Fabian Blechschmidt
quelle
Gibt es Neuigkeiten, wenn dies eine gute Option war?
Wouter
Zumindest nicht von meiner Seite.
Fabian Blechschmidt